Aracılığıyla paylaş


DQS Etkinliklerini İzleme

Şunlar için geçerlidir: SQL Server

Önemli

Sql Server 2025'te (17.x) Veri Kalitesi Hizmetleri (DQS) kaldırılmıştır . SQL Server 2022 (16.x) ve önceki sürümlerde DQS'yi desteklemeye devam ediyoruz.

Bu konuda, Veri Kalitesi Hizmetleri'nde (DQS) aşağıdaki etkinliklerin nasıl merkezi olarak izleneceği açıklanır: bilgi bulma, etki alanı yönetimi, eşleşen ilke, veri temizleme, veri eşleştirme ve SSIS temizleme.

Başlamadan Önce

Sınırlamalar ve Kısıtlamalar

Yalnızca DQS_Main veritabanında dqs_administrator rolüne sahip kullanıcılar bir etkinliği sonlandırabilir veya etkinlik içindeki bir işlemi durdurabilir.

Güvenlik

İzinler

  • DQS etkinliklerini görüntülemek için DQS_MAIN veritabanında dqs_kb_editor veya dqs_kb_operator rolüne sahip olmanız gerekir.

  • Bir etkinliği sonlandırmak veya DQS etkinliklerini görüntülemeye ek olarak bir etkinlik içindeki bir işlemi durdurmak için DQS_MAIN veritabanında dqs_administrator rolüne sahip olmanız gerekir.

DQS Etkinliklerini Görüntüleme

  1. Veri Kalitesi İstemcisi'ni başlatın. Bunu yapma hakkında bilgi için bkz. Veri Kalitesi İstemci Uygulamasını çalıştırma.

  2. Veri Kalitesi İstemcisi giriş ekranında Etkinlik İzleme'ye tıklayın. Etkinlik izleme ekranı görüntülenir.

    Etkinlik İzleme ekranı

  3. Etkinlik izleme ekranı, etkinlik kılavuzundaki her etkinlikle ilgili bilgileri görüntüler. Etkinlik kılavuzu her DQS etkinliği hakkında aşağıdaki bilgileri görüntüler:

    Kimlik: Tamsayı değeri. Etkinlik izleme için sistem tarafından oluşturulan benzersiz etkinlik numarası.

    Ad: Bu etkinlik için kullanılan bilgi bankası veya veri kalitesi projesinin adı.

    Etkin: Etkinliğin şu anda etkin olup olmadığını gösterir. Aşağıdaki değerlere sahip olabilir:

    • Aktif: Faaliyet şu anda devam ediyor.

    • Sona erdi: Etkinlik tamamlandı.

    • Sonlandırıldı: Etkinlik, DQS yöneticisi tarafından etkinlik izleme ekranı kullanılarak sonlandırıldı veya etkinlik, Veri Kalitesi İstemcisi'ndeki ilgili özellik alanında çalıştırılırken kullanıcı tarafından iptal edildi.

    Tür: Etkinlik türünü gösterir. Alt Tür , bir etkinlik türü için yürütülen belirli iş akışını gösterir. Aşağıdaki etkinlik türleri izlenir:

    • Bilgi Yönetimi alt türleri:

      • Bilgi Keşfi

      • Etki Alanı Yönetimi

      • Eşleştirme Politikası

    • DQ Projesi alt türleri:

      • Temizlik

      • ile eşleşen

    • SSIS Temizleme alt türleri:

      • Temizlik

    Geçerli Durum: Bir etkinliğin geçerli durumunu gösterir. Etkinlik durumu son hesaplama işlemi tarafından belirlenir. Bir etkinlikte bulma işlemini birkaç kez çalıştırma gibi çeşitli hesaplama işlemleri olabileceğini unutmayın (bilgi bulma etkinliğinin içinde). Bu nedenle, etkinlik ömrü boyunca durum birkaç kez değişebilir.

    Geçerli Durum aşağıdaki değerlere sahip olabilir:

    • Çalışıyor: Hesaplama işlemi çalışıyor.

    • Başarılı: Bu durum, bir hesaplama işlemi çalışmadan önce ve bir hesaplama işlemi başarıyla sona erdikten sonra yeniden ayarlanır.

    • Başarısız: Hesaplama işlemi başarısız oldu.

    • Durduruldu: Hesaplama işlemi durduruldu.

    DQKB: Etkinlik için kullanılan bilgi bankasının adı.

    Kullanıcı: Etkinliği başlatan kullanıcının veya etkinlik üzerinde çalışan son kullanıcının adı (aynı olmaması durumunda).

    Etkinlik Başlangıç Saati: Etkinliğin başlatıldığı tarih ve saat

    Geçen Süre: Etkinlik başlatıldıktan sonra geçen süre. HH:MM:SS formatında görüntülenir.

    Etkinlik Bitiş Saati: Etkinliğin sona erdiği tarih ve saat.

DQS Etkinlik Bilgilerini Filtreleme

Belirli filtre ölçütlerine göre gerekli etkinlikleri filtrelemek ve görüntülemek için etkinlik izleme ekranında filtreleme bölmesini (Filtre Ölçütü, Değer, Başlangıç Tarihi ve Bitiş Tarihi) kullanabilirsiniz. Etkinlik kayıtlarını filtrelemek için:

  1. Filtreleme ölçütüne karar verin: Etkinlik kayıtlarını etkinlik kılavuzundaki sütunlardan birindeki bir değere göre (değer tabanlı) veya bir tarih aralığına veya her ikisine göre filtrelemek isteyip istemediğiniz.

    1. Değer tabanlı filtreleme: Filtre Ölçütü listesinden bir filtre ölçütü seçin ve ardından Değer listesinde filtre uygulamak için uygun değeri seçin. Filter By listesinde bir seçenek belirtildiğinde, Değer listesi olası değerlerle güncellenir. Etkinlik kayıtlarında aşağıdaki alanlara göre filtreleyebilirsiniz: Etkin,Tür, Alt Tür, Geçerli Durum, DQKB ve Kullanıcı.

    2. Tarih aralığı tabanlı filtreleme: Başlangıç Tarihive Bitiş tarihi denetimlerinde uygun tarihleri seçme. Varsayılan olarak, Başlangıç Tarihi'nde görüntülenen tarih geçerli tarihten iki gün öncedir ve Bitiş Tarihi'nde görüntülenen tarih geçerli tarihtir. Filtreleme, başlangıçve bitiş tarihlerine göre değil, aralığa göre yapılır. Bu, seçilen tarihler aralığında çalışan her etkinliğin görüntüleneceği anlamına gelir.

  2. Filtreleme uygulamak için Etkinlikler listesini yenile simgesine tıklayın ve yalnızca filtrelenmiş DQS etkinliklerini görüntüleyin.

DQS Etkinlik Ayrıntılarını Görüntüleme

Etkinlik izleme ekranında etkinlik adımları ve profil oluşturucu bilgileri gibi bir DQS etkinliğinin ayrıntılı bilgilerini görüntüleyebilirsiniz. Bunu yapmak için:

  1. Etkinlik kılavuzunda (üst bölmede) bir DQS etkinliği seçin.

  2. Alt bölmede, aşağıdaki 2 sekmenin altında seçili etkinliğin etkinlik ayrıntıları görüntülenir:

    • Etkinlik Adımları: Seçili etkinlikle ilişkili hesaplama işlemlerinin (etkinlik adımları) kılavuzunu görüntüler. Bu sekmenin altında bir etkinlik için çeşitli etkinlik adımları görüntülenebilir. Etkinlikteki aynı etkinlik adımının kullanıcı tarafından birkaç kez çalıştırılması durumunda bu durum oluşabilir. Örneğin etkinlik adımı durduruldu ve yeniden başlatıldı. Bu sekmenin altındaki kılavuz, etkinlikle ilişkili her etkinlik adımı için aşağıdaki bilgileri görüntüler: Tür, Geçerli Durum, Başlangıç Saati, Geçen Saat ve Bitiş Saati.

    • Profil Oluşturucu: Geçerli ve geçmiş etkinlikler için profil oluşturma bilgilerini görüntüler. Geçerli etkinlikler için kısmi ancak tutarlı bilgiler içerir. Bir etkinliğin profil oluşturma bilgileri, ilgili etkinlik ayrıntılarını bir Excel dosyasına aktardığınızda Excel dosyasına aktarılır. Bilgiler, dışarı aktarılan Excel dosyasındaki Profil Oluşturucu - Kaynak ve Profil Oluşturucu - Alanlar sayfalarında bulunur.

DQS Etkinlik Ayrıntılarını Dışarı Aktarma

İzleme ekranındaki bir etkinliğin etkinlik özelliklerini, etkinlik işlemlerini ve profil oluşturma bilgilerini excel dosyasına aktarabilirsiniz. Bunu yapmak için:

  1. Etkinlik kılavuzunda (üst bölmede) bir etkinlik seçin.

  2. Seçili etkinliği Excel'e aktar simgesine tıklayın. Alternatif olarak, etkinlik kılavuzundaki herhangi bir etkinliğe sağ tıklayın ve kısayol menüsünde Etkinliği Dışarı Aktar'a tıklayın.

  3. Kaydedilecek Excel dosyası için bir ad ve konum belirtmeniz istenir. Dışarı aktarılan Excel dosyası aşağıdaki sayfaları içerir:

    Sayfa Adı Açıklama
    Etkinlik Etkinlik kılavuzunda olduğu gibi etkinlikle ilgili bilgileri (sütunları) içerir.
    Süreç Etkinlik Adımları sekmesinde olduğu gibi etkinlikteki işlemler hakkında bilgiler (sütunlar) içerir.
    Profil Oluşturucu - Kaynak Temizleme alt türü için etkinlik hakkında şu bilgileri içerir: Kayıtlar, Doğru Kayıtlar, Düzeltilen Kayıtlar ve Geçersiz Kayıtlar.

    Bilgi Bulma, Etki Alanı Yönetimi, Eşleştirme İlkesi ve Eşleşen alt türleri için etkinlik hakkında şu bilgileri içerir: Kayıtlar, Toplam Değerler, Yeni Değerler, Benzersiz Değerler ve Yeni Benzersiz Değerler.
    Profil Oluşturucu - Alanlar Temizleme ve SSIS Temizleme alt türleri için etkinlik hakkında şu bilgileri içerir: Alan, Etki Alanı, Düzeltilen Değerler, Önerilen Değerler, Tamlık ve Doğruluk.

    Bilgi Bulma, Etki Alanı Yönetimi, Eşleştirme İlkesi ve Eşleşen alt türleri için etkinlik hakkında şu bilgileri içerir: Alan, Etki Alanı, Yeni, Benzersiz, Etki Alanında Geçerli ve Eksiksizlik.

DQS Etkinliğini Sonlandırma

DQS yöneticileri (dqs_administrator rolü), SSIS Temizleme tipinde olmayan çalışan (aktif) bir etkinliği durdurabilir. Etkinliği sonlandırmak etkinlikteki tüm çalışan işlemleri durdurur ve etkinlikle ilgili olan her şeyi kaldırır. Bu işlem geri alınamaz. Etkinlik izleme ekranında etkinliği sonlandırmak, Veri Kalitesi İstemcisi'ndeki özellik alanında çalıştırılırken İptal'e tıklayarak ilgili etkinliği iptal etmeye eşdeğerdir. Bir etkinliği sonlandırmak için:

  1. Etkinlik kılavuzunda (üst bölmede) çalışan bir etkinlik seçin.

  2. Seçili etkinliği sonlandır simgesine tıklayın. Alternatif olarak, etkinlik kılavuzundaki etkinliğe sağ tıklayın ve ardından kısayol menüsünde Etkinliği Sonlandır'a tıklayın.

  3. Eyleminizi onaylamak için bir ileti görüntülenir. Evettıklayın.

DQS Aktivitesinde İşlemi Durdurma

DQS yöneticileri (dqs_administrator rol), SSIS Temizleme türünde olmayan bir etkinlikte çalışan (etkin) bir işlemi durdurabilir. Etkinlik izleme ekranında bir işlemin durdurulması, Veri Kalitesi İstemcisi'ndeki özellik alanında ilgili etkinlik içinde işlemi durdurmakla eşdeğerdir. Örneğin, bir temizleme etkinliği içinde bilgisayar destekli temizleme işlemini durdurma veya eşleşen bir etkinlik içinde eşleştirme işlemini durdurma. Durdurulan bir işlem etkinlik izleme ekranından yeniden başlatılamaz. Veri Kalitesi İstemcisi'ndeki ilgili özellik alanından işlemi yeniden başlatmanız gerekir. Bu durumda, Etkinlik Adımları sekmesindeki işlemler kılavuzuna ek bir satır eklenir. Durdurulan işlem durumu Durduruldu olarak görüntülenmeye devam eder. Bir işlemi durdurmak için:

  1. Etkinlik ayrıntıları kılavuzunda (alt bölmede) çalışan bir işlem seçin.

  2. Seçili işlemi durdur simgesine tıklayın. Alternatif olarak, etkinlik ayrıntıları kılavuzunda işleme sağ tıklayın ve ardından kısayol menüsünde İşlemi Durdur'a tıklayın.

  3. Eyleminizi onaylamak için bir ileti görüntülenir. Evettıklayın.